Plumber Services in Queensburgh, KwaZulu-Natal
Plumbing services in Queensburgh, KwaZulu-Natal cover a broad range of domestic and commercial needs, reflecting the area's mix of residential suburbs and small businesses. Local plumbers typically handle urgent repairs as well as planned installations, drawing on experience with both older, established homes and newer properties. The common goal is to restore reliable water supply and drainage while minimising disruption to daily life.
Emergency call-outs are a familiar feature in this region, where leaks, burst pipes, or blocked drains can quickly cause damage in humid, warm climates. A typical response involves a rapid on-site assessment to identify the source of a problem, followed by a plan to stop leaks, clear blockages, or secure the affected area. After initial mitigation, a more thorough repair or replacement can be scheduled, subject to access, material availability, and safety considerations. In all cases, customers can expect transparency about the nature of the fault and the likely steps required to resolve it.
Common services in Queensburgh often include:
- Emergency repairs for leaks, bursts, and other urgent plumbing faults
- Drainage and blocked drainage clearing for sinks, showers, baths, and toilets
- Repair and replacement of taps, valves, and other fittings to prevent water wastage
- Geyser and hot-water system installation, servicing, and repair, including temperature and pressure controls
- Pipework alterations, optimising water flow, and upgrading older copper or steel piping where necessary
- Waste disposal and toilet repairs, including replacement of fixtures and sealants to prevent odours and leaks
- installations of rainwater harvesting systems and basic plumbing for household appliances
When engaging a plumber in Queensburgh, customers can typically expect a professional assessment that may include a written estimate or quotation after the initial visit. The process usually begins with a diagnostic check, identifying the fault, and outlining the scope of work, required parts, and a timeframe for completion. Some jobs can be completed in a single visit, while others may require parts or equipment that necessitate a follow-up appointment. Clear communication about timing, costs, and any potential disruptions helps manage expectations.
Practical considerations are important for residents and businesses alike. Access to properties in Queensburgh can vary, and some locations may require careful planning for foam insulation, floor protection, or multi-storey access. Plumbers typically bring a range of common fittings, seals, and tools, but specialised components might need procurement, which can influence both schedule and price. Transparent pricing practices—where possible—include itemised estimates and a discussion of call-out charges, labour rates, and any potential extra costs arising from unforeseen complications.
Safety and compliance form part of standard practice. Plumbers operate within general health and safety guidelines, ensure water systems are restored to regulatory standards, and advise on routine maintenance to reduce the risk of recurring issues. For households, routine checks on geysers, pressure relief valves, and drainage cleanliness can extend system life and improve efficiency. For businesses, commercial plumbing work may involve adherence to broader statutory requirements and building regulations, particularly when installing or upgrading water supply and waste systems.
